The Risks And Benefits Associated With Restylane
by: Julie Bricklin
Hyaluronic acid is a natural sugar compound, and the second largest component of human skin next to collagen. It’s the main ingredient of Restalyne, and has been harnessed to become one of the hottest new cosmetic procedures. It’s touted as being less allergy provoking than other substances, and can hold 1,000 times its own weight in water, which allows it to restore significant volume in wrinkles and lines of the skin.

Restylane Injection - Reduces Wrinkles And Plump Lips
by: Renee Billancourt
Restylane is an injectable filler that is utilized to combat aging by filling in lines and wrinkles in the facial area. Restylane injections are used to improve facial contouring, lip augmentation, and wrinkles that appear on the forehead, eyebrow, and nasolabial wrinkles. (Mouth area) The chemical make up of Restylane is that of hyaluronic acid. While foreign sounding in name is chemical substance that is naturally found in the human body.

How Does this Cosmetic Injectable Work?
by: Michele Ellingsen
Restylane® is a very good and popular dermal filler, chosen by many patients throughout the world. Next to Botox®, Restylane® is the second-most-common injectable used in the United States. It works by plumping up creases under the skin, making it particularly well suited for use on the lower face. Restylane results tend to last up to 6 months, which is longer than some other fillers.
